--- linuxsampler/trunk/configure.in 2007/04/16 15:51:18 1161 +++ linuxsampler/trunk/configure.in 2007/05/06 16:38:35 1175 @@ -309,11 +309,12 @@ AC_SUBST(GIG_LIBS) # Check presence of sqlite3 +AC_CHECK_PROG(HAVE_SQLITE3_CMD, sqlite3, true, false) sqlite_version="3.3" PKG_CHECK_MODULES(SQLITE3, sqlite3 >= $sqlite_version, HAVE_SQLITE3=true, HAVE_SQLITE3=false) AC_SUBST(SQLITE3_LIBS) AC_SUBST(SQLITE3_CFLAGS) -if test $HAVE_SQLITE3 = false; then +if test $HAVE_SQLITE3_CMD = false -o $HAVE_SQLITE3 = false; then HAVE_SQLITE3=0; instruments_db_support="no" echo "*** Required sqlite version not found!" @@ -861,6 +862,15 @@ echo "Call './configure --help' for further information or read configure.in." exit -1; fi +else + case "$config_signed_triang_algo" in + intmath) + triang_signed=2 ;; + diharmonic) + triang_signed=3 ;; + intmathabs) + triang_signed=5 ;; + esac fi AC_DEFINE_UNQUOTED(CONFIG_SIGNED_TRIANG_ALGO, ${triang_signed}, [Define signed triangular wave algorithm to be used.]) @@ -892,6 +902,15 @@ echo "Call './configure --help' for further information or read configure.in." exit -1; fi +else + case "$config_unsigned_triang_algo" in + intmath) + triang_unsigned=2 ;; + diharmonic) + triang_unsigned=3 ;; + intmathabs) + triang_unsigned=5 ;; + esac fi AC_DEFINE_UNQUOTED(CONFIG_UNSIGNED_TRIANG_ALGO, ${triang_unsigned}, [Define unsigned triangular wave algorithm to be used.]) @@ -940,7 +959,7 @@ Artwork/Makefile \ scripts/Makefile \ osx/Makefile \ - osx/LinuxSampler.xcode/Makefile \ + osx/linuxsampler.xcodeproj/Makefile \ Documentation/Makefile \ Documentation/Engines/Makefile \ Documentation/Engines/gig/Makefile \